Hello Christian, it's important to know the difference between the input-tree and the output-tree. You can't access the calculated values after the first gap, if you only write them to the output-tree. The best solution in my eyes is to use a recursive template, which processes node by node: <xsl:template match="root"> <!-- copy all As and Bs before any gap, because they must not be processed recursively --> <xsl:variable name="before-gap" select="(A|B)[not(preceding-sibling::C)]"/> <xsl:copy-of select="$before-gap"/> <!-- apply templates on the first A or B after a gap --> <xsl:apply-templates select="(A|B)[preceding-sibling::C][1]"> <xsl:with-param name="start" select="$before-gap[last()]/@end + 1"/> </xsl:apply-templates> </xsl:template> <xsl:template match="A|B"> <xsl:param name="start" select="1"/> <xsl:variable name="end" select="$start + (@end - @start)"/> <xsl:copy> <xsl:attribute name="start"><xsl:value-of select="$start"/></xsl:attribute> <xsl:attribute name="end"><xsl:value-of select="$end"/></xsl:attribute> <xsl:apply-templates/> </xsl:copy> <xsl:apply-templates select="following-sibling::*[self::A or self::B][1]"> <xsl:with-param name="start" select="$end + 1"/> </xsl:apply-templates> </xsl:template> You have got already a solution with for-each from Michael Kay. But there every preceding node must be accessed and totalized again. According to your file size this will make no difference, but when it's big you will see the time differences. Furthermore you can shorten the code in the first template if you process the first nodes in front of the frst C too, i.e. calculating their @start and @end too, even it's not needed, because you know already the values: <xsl:template match="root"> <xsl:apply-templates select="(A|B)[1]"> <xsl:with-param name="start" select="(A|B)[1]/@start"/> </xsl:apply-templates> </xsl:template> Regards, Joerg > hello *.*, > following xml-file: > > <A start="20" end="28">Text1</A> > <B start="29" end="35">Text2</B> > <C start="36" end="39">Text3</C> > <C start="40" end="44">Text4</C> > <A start="45" end="51">Text5</A> > <C start="52" end="58">Text6</C> > <B start="59" end="69">Text7</B> > ... > > i want to write a xslt file which removes all <C> elements (no problem) and > recalculates start and end values by filling up the gaps. and here i have > the problem: in the first case it is possible to fill up the gab between the > first <B> and second <A>: > > 1: <A start="20" end="28">Text1</A> > 2: <B start="29" end="35">Text2</B> > 3: <!-- removed <C> element(s) --> > 4: <A start="36" end="42">Text5</A> > 5: <!-- removed <C> element(s) --> > 6: <B start="52" end="62">Text7</B> (problem!!!) > > The problem arises at the second gap (line 6). the gap is calculated by > using end value of second <A> and start value of last <B> (59-51=8) and not > by using already recalculated values in previous step (59-42=17). > > what's going wrong here? has anyone a hint or maybe a solution for me? > > any help would be appreciated! > > regards > christian XSL-List info and archive: http://www.mulberrytech.com/xsl/xsl-list
